Foreword

This report gathers the signal of three moments of inquiry — Session 1 (March 14, 2026) and Session 2 (April 11, 2026) of the Guides' Collective Wisdom Sessions, and the foundational 37-facilitator study documented in the research paper "A Global Exploration of the Evolving Consciousness of Humanity" from the 2023/2024 MNI LBL Facilitator Project — and asks them to speak to each other.

The question that shaped the document is simple and demanding: in the short but pivotal window between these inquiries — roughly two to three years, and a shift of method from individual Life Between Lives sessions to collective group sessions — what has remained constant, what has evolved, what is genuinely new, and what does the dialogue between the individual LBL session and the collective session reveal?

The answers form a single unfolding conversation. The guides have not changed their song. The harmonies have deepened, the urgency has sharpened, and the listeners have been asked to stand closer together.

Two Sessions, One Voice

Sessions 1 and 2, held four weeks apart, were designed as independent inquiries — different questions, different facilitators for the induction, different emphases. Yet as the transcripts settled into analysis, it became undeniable that they are two movements of a single composition.

Session 1 — March 14, 2026

Three questions, focused on the path forward: the most important thing humanity needs to understand, the role of collective consciousness in healing, and the deeper purpose of the current challenges. Seven participants were documented. Fourteen master themes emerged, with seven achieving unanimous convergence.

Session 2 — April 11, 2026

Seven questions, markedly more searching in register: what suffering is teaching us, where we still organise life around domination, what we are refusing to grieve, who is being silenced, whether we can build systems that reduce suffering rather than manage it, what love looks like as policy and infrastructure, and whether humanity is ready to move from parallel suffering into shared responsibility. Seven participants were documented. Twelve master themes emerged.

The Arc Between

Session 1 is structured like a horizon. Session 2 is structured like a mirror. The first lifted participants' gaze toward what is possible; the second asked them to look directly at what is being avoided. This is not a shift in tone but a completion: the guides who promised in March that "it is all peace already" asked in April "what are we collectively refusing to grieve?" The answer to the second question is the precondition for experiencing the truth of the first.
